Before engaging lettings services, be clear about your objectives: whether you’re letting a single property or building a portfolio, expecting long-term residential tenants or managing seasonal lets. Understand your responsibilities as a landlord under Welsh tenancy law, including deposit holding, written agreements, and maintenance standards—these form the foundation of compliant lettings management. Ask about how a lettings service handles vetting, rent collection, and emergency repairs, particularly in Barry where properties are spread across terraced streets, suburban roads, and newer developments. Consider whether you need full property management (including maintenance coordination) or lettings-only services focused on tenant placement and rent.
Barry’s character as a mixed residential and coastal town means rental demand varies by location and property type—a Victorian terrace in town centre will attract different tenants than a semi-detached family home on the edge of town, and both differ from purpose-built flats suited to young professionals or shorter lets. Local knowledge of Barry’s school catchments, transport links, and seasonal patterns helps target the right tenants and set realistic rents. Experience with Barry’s stock also reveals common maintenance issues tied to age and construction type, allowing proactive management. Understanding how holiday-let activity affects certain streets and neighbourhoods helps protect your lettings strategy from seasonal competition.
